Ben Rayment of Monckton Chambers will be speaking on ”Limitation periods: when does the time start running?” at the conference in Paris on 25 October.

This conference aims to look into the complex issues of implementation and the challenges to be faced by national judges, as well as legal counsel for defendants and claimants in antitrust damages litigation.

Key topics:

  • Directive 2014/104/EU and the way forward
  • Challenging issues of compensation and quantification
  • The study on the passing-on of overcharges
  • Procedural challenges
  • The role of the CJEU and national competition authorities.
